Powerchair football is played in electric sports wheelchairs with bumpers on the front of them. Games are played 4 v 4 on a basketball court, are 40 minutes long, and there are currently around 100 clubs in the U.K. Since there is no advantage given for size or age, participants as young as 7 can play competitively with 70 year olds!
